ELECTROMAGNETICS ASSIGNMENT 2

1. A resonant transmission line carries 81 watts in the forward direction and 9 watts in the reverse direction. Determine the standing wave ratio SWR on the line.
2. Briefly explain each of the following parameters which describe the performance of an antenna.
a. Aperture
b. Gain
c. Reciprocity
d. Antenna impedance
3. Calculate the SWR of a transmission line whose characteristic impedance is 300 ohms and is terminated in a load resistance of 100 ohms.
4. A load impedance 130+j90Ω terminates a 50Ω transmission line that is 0.3 long. Find:
i. the reflection coefficient at the load
ii. the reflection coefficient at the input to the line
iii. The SWR on the line
iv. The return loss
v. Impedance seen at the input to the line.
